MER57E3 transposable element subfamily co-opted for gene regulation in human early neural development
2025-04-07
Abstract excerpt
<title>Abstract</title> <p> Background Long dismissed as mere genomic parasites, transposable elements (TEs) are now recognized as major drivers of genome evolution. TEs serve as a source of cell-type specific <italic>cis</italic> -regulatory elements, influencing gene expression and observable phenotypes. However, the precise TE regulatory roles in different contexts remain largely unexplored and the impact...
